Optical 90 degrees Hybrids Based on Silicon-on-Insulator Multimode Interference Couplers | |

英文摘要 | An optical 90 degrees hybrids based on silicon-on-insulator (SOI) 4x4 MMI couplers have been fabricated in 340nm top silicon using E-Beam technology. Below 2.2 degrees phase deviation of the hybrids for the across C-band of TE mode have been simulated, which is well satisfied with the typical systems requirements. The measured optical transmission powers from port to port show that the devices function well as a 6dB power divider with excess loss around 1dB at wavelength lambda=1550nm for TE mode.
